原文:git 提交代码到新的库,不保留原来的提交历史记录

git checkout orphan source 新建一个没有提交记录的分支 git add . git commit m init git remote v 查看下git库地址 git remote remove origin 删除原有的git库 git remote add origin git地址 git push origin source ...

2019-03-18 18:42 0 552 推荐指数:

查看详情

git删除所有提交历史记录

以下方法是在当前的分支下新建一个分支,然后把之前分支删除,接着把新建的分支重命名为原分支名称,最后把分支强制推送到远程 1.Checkout git checkout --orphan latest_branch 2. Add all the files git add -A 3. Commit ...

Mon Jun 26 23:38:00 CST 2017 0 3274
git项目提交到另一个新建的git项目中去,保留提交历史记录

如何将git项目提交到另一个新建的git项目中去,保留提交历史记录一、创建git项目二、idea绑定新建远程git仓库三、刷新git远程分支,并切换到分支四、将老分支提交git仓库中如何将git项目提交到另一个新建的git项目中去,保留提交历史记录一、创建git项目在git管控页面中点 ...

Thu Oct 14 17:44:00 CST 2021 0 971
git删除所有提交历史记录

这种方式是最快最有效的 进项目根目录启动git bash,然后执行这些即可 最后的 git push -f origin master 会失败,直接在idea里push就能成功了 ...

Sun Sep 16 01:40:00 CST 2018 0 1413
git代码迁移-保留历史提交记录

一、从迁出仓库git中复制出http地址链接 git clone --bare -b dev http://xxxxxxxx/iridescent/workweixin.git 二、在本地创建文件夹 new,进入本文件夹中,右键打开git的 bash 窗口, 三、git clone ...

Thu Jun 17 02:14:00 CST 2021 0 212
GIT如何根据历史记录回退代码

ps: 因为使用这种方式回退后,回退的目标版本之后提交代码都没了,所以建议先把当前代码打个tag 首先找到分支的提交记录 git log 将代码回退到历史版本 git reset --hard 0ff6ef442e67adb86ccd4f167a55a154a6917a5e 强行 ...

Mon Aug 20 17:53:00 CST 2018 0 2051
多个git合并,并保留log历史记录

面临的需求是:将多个git仓库作为一个单独目录,整合到一个git仓库中;并且保留历史记录。 1. 新建一个summary仓库 新建一个summary仓库,用于整合一系列git仓库。 2. 将其它git仓库merge到summary中 至此就将 ...

Thu Jul 04 08:00:00 CST 2019 0 1787
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M